How they compare

Guatemala currently reports 49,567 t against 48,370 t in Morocco, a difference of 1,197 t.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 57 shared years of data; in 1968 it was Morocco ahead.

Guatemala ranks 61st and Morocco ranks 62nd of 199 countries.

Morocco has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Guatemala Morocco Difference Ahead
1960s 5,650 t 12,600 t 6,950 t Morocco
1970s 11,680 t 13,220 t 1,540 t Morocco
1980s 10,710 t 17,850 t 7,140 t Morocco
1990s 2,430 t 19,472 t 17,042 t Morocco
2000s 1,170 t 24,343 t 23,173 t Morocco
2010s 7,190 t 46,869 t 39,679 t Morocco
2020s 29,381 t 51,683 t 22,302 t Morocco

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
